This webinar, hosted by Stephen Figg, features Sean Knapp of Ascend.io, Mark Lombardi of Astronomer, and Saket Sarab of Nexla, who discuss top trends in data engineering for 2025. Sean highlights the productivity increase in data teams but notes concerns about workload capacity and maintenance time, advocating for automation. Mark emphasizes the shift of data operations to operational use cases and the importance of data observability and introduces Airflow 3. Saket introduces Nexla as a converged platform for data and workflow integration, powered by metadata, and discusses its role in generative AI applications. The speakers then engage in a group discussion about the top challenges in data engineering, exciting trends, the impact of AI, and game-changing platforms and tools, as well as the evolving role and important skills for data engineers.
